What Triggers Drain Blockages and How to Address Them?
Clogged drains can disrupt daily routines and lead to costly repairs if not addressed promptly. Various factors contribute to this common issue. Collection of hair strands, soap deposits, food remnants, and fatty substances commonly produces obstructions in sink drains. Moreover, unwanted objects including children's toys or bathroom products can intensify the issue, specifically in home plumbing. Root systems penetrating buried pipelines may equally cause substantial blockage.
To fix clogged drains, homeowners should first of all identify the source. Common tools including plungers or drain snakes could suffice for small clogs. However, persistent blockages may demand professional intervention. Drain cleaning services employ advanced methods, such as hydro-jetting and camera inspections, to completely clear blockages and assess the condition of pipes. Regular maintenance, including scheduled inspections and proper disposal practices, is vital in preventing future clogs and ensuring efficient drainage throughout the home.
Proven DIY Techniques for Cleaning Drains
Homeowners can efficiently handle simple drain problems with a few simple DIY approaches. One popular method involves utilizing a blend of baking soda and vinegar. This blend can aid in breaking down simple clogs by generating a fizzing reaction, which removes debris. Put a cup of baking soda and then a cup of vinegar down the drain, wait for about 30 minutes, and then flush with hot water.
Using a plunger is another effective technique. Plungers can dislodge stubborn blockages by creating a vacuum seal around the drain. It's important that homeowners ensure enough water in the sink covers the plunger's cup for best results.
For continued upkeep, a monthly flush of hot water can assist in remove grease accumulation. Additionally, employing a drain snake can extract hair and gunk from the pipe's surface. These practices can ensure drains flowing properly without requiring professional assistance.

Categories of Drain Cleaning Services
When homeowners face persistent clogs or drainage issues, various types of drain cleaning services can effectively address these problems. One common method is snaking, which involves using a flexible auger to break up blockages in pipes. Hydro jetting represents another sophisticated method that uses high-pressure water streams to dislodge stubborn debris and accumulated grease. For more severe cases, video camera inspections permit professionals to identify the exact location and nature of the clog, delivering targeted solutions. Chemical drain cleaners are sometimes applied for minor blockages, though they should be used with caution due to potential pipe damage. Additionally, rooter services focus specifically on removing tree roots that infiltrate drainage systems. Each service offers distinct advantages, allowing homeowners to select the most appropriate method based on the severity and nature of their drainage issues. Cost Factors for Drain Cleaning Services
A number of factors influence the cost of drain cleaning services, making it necessary for homeowners to comprehend these variables before seeking assistance. To start, the type of blockage plays a substantial role; less complex clogs typically require less time and fewer resources, while substantial blockages may necessitate advanced equipment and techniques, elevating costs.
Moreover, the placement of the clog affects pricing; drains situated far into plumbing systems or in hard-to-reach areas can lead to higher costs.
The expertise and professional background of service providers further result in price fluctuations, as established companies often charge more owing to their reputation and track record.
In conclusion, geographical area can influence costs, with urban areas generally seeing elevated prices versus rural settings. Comprehending these elements can help homeowners in making educated choices when selecting drain cleaning services.
Preventative Steps to Maintain Your Drains Free-Flowing
Grasping the costs connected to drain cleaning services is beneficial, but homeowners can also take preventive steps to stop clogs before they become expensive issues. Regular maintenance is essential; routine inspections can pinpoint potential problems early. Homeowners should avoid pouring grease, oil, or food scraps down kitchen sinks, as these substances can solidify and cause blockages. In bathrooms, using drain guards can trap hair and soap residue, substantially reducing buildup.
Furthermore, running drains with hot water weekly can help dissolving minor clogs. Homeowners can also consider employing natural cleaners, such as baking soda and vinegar, to preserve clear pipes without hazardous chemicals. Seasonal maintenance, including removing debris from outdoor drains, can avoid backups during intense rainfall. By adopting these preventative measures, homeowners can ensure their plumbing systems remain operational, consequently saving time and money on emergency drain cleaning services.
